It also matters what your host is being used for.  If it is used for security logging, for example, your log files might be an hour off.  I have also seen an issue with digitally signed images (for security cameras) that couldn't be verified because the time was an hour off.  On the other hand, if there is nothing "time restrictive" about your server, then it shouldn't be troublesome and should "fix itself" on April 1st.
